The Sint-Mauritius Church is a Roman Catholic parish church in the district of Kärlich in the German town of Mülheim-Kärlich, Rhineland-Palatinate.
Originally, the church was a proprietary church, which was granted by a charter dated March 10, 1217, to the St. Florinus Foundation in Koblenz. Associated with this donation was the authority of the provost of the foundation to appoint the parish priests of Kärlich. The connection with the Florinus Foundation lasted until the secularization in 1802. From 1827 to 1924, Kärlich was part of the deanery of Koblenz, and since February 1, 1924, the parish has been assigned to the deanery of Bassenheim, which merged with Andernach in 2004 to form the deanery of Andernach-Bassenheim.
